Question REZNOR gas shop heater WHOOMP ! on ignition

I have a ceiling hung REZNOR natural gas shop heater in my 800 sq ft garage. It’s 10 yrs old now and two yrs ago, the pilot light would not stay lit. Sometimes I could relight it and it’d be OK for a while, but I ended up replacing it. Same thing at the beginning of the ’08 heating season, then again at the end of the Spring ’09. I replaced the thermocouple, three times now. In itself, that seems like a problem.

Before starting up the heater this Fall, I put in a new Honeywell thermocouple. Over the last several days, the heater started making a WHOOMP sound when the burners ignite and a small gas ignition flash was visible at the bottom of the unit. Clearly not good. Carrot Top’s career would be ended if he were standing underneath when it lights. I’m in no such danger as my head is free of hair being at risk of being singed.

I did some research and found this forum, but I’d read, and it may have been somewhere else, or here, to check and clean the burners. I shut off the heater’s gas and power, dropped the burner tray and swept out the very small amount of crumbs/debris that had accumulated over the years in the tray. The five burners are stamped (stainless?) steel and I blew them out with compressed air, noticing that virtually nothing was dislodged. The burners look very clean, but I used a wire brush to brush the tops, as one tech advised in one of the forums I had found online.

I also probed the five orifices in the gas manifold to check for obstructions. All were clear. I blew a little compressed air into the manifold for good measure.

I started the heater back up and the first ignition was smooth and quiet. The flames are even, without gaps and consistent blue flame color. I turned the thermostat back down, let it cool, then turned it back ON. I hear the call for heat switch, but there seems to be maybe one second of delay to ignition. The second ignition made a small whoomp sound, then the third, WHOOMP and a visible flash under the heater.

I blew compressed air into the burners again, relit the pilot and turned the heater back ON. Quiet, no frills ignition….the first time. The second, WHOOMP. Very notable ignition flash.

The next test I did was to cycle the call for heat ON then OFF without letting the unit cool all the way down, meaning I would turn the thermostat back up while the fan was still running and blowing hot air out the front. Doing this resulted in repeated, quiet, reigniting of the burners. Hmmm.

I checked the heat exchanger for cracks, rust, etc and the exchanger looks to be in great shape. I remember a few years a go seeing the exchanger in my parent’s 40 yr old furnace. Now that was BAD!

The last test I did was to check the flue and draw. There’s no logical reason for the flue not to draw suddenly after 9 heating seasons, unless a squirrel took up residence, but the critter cage on the cap is intact and a smoke test with some burning newspaper proved the flue was drawing just fine.

Obviously, there is a gas buildup before ignition. If it was a problem with the burners, then why would they ALL have a clean, blue flame front to back? My suspicion is the valve (what else is there?) partly because the pilot light issue the past two seasons. Maybe that was the warning the electronics were starting to go.

Post a pic of the pilot flame. If it is the wrong size/dirty orifice etc that may be burning out the thermocouple. You are getting delayed ignition and that is VERY dangerous. Need to get a tech to check the manifold pressure of the gas valve. May be too high or low and causing a problem, not a DIY task. Or the gas valve is sticking. Or the burners need to be physically removed and the crossover slots cleaned and or wash out the burners with hot water running in a sink. Carrier TUAs are bad for that.

Gas valves are not adjustable/fixable and most of the time set correctly from the factory. Your pilot looks too strong and a glowing thermocouple usually burns out. If you don't have the proper shape of pilot flame that can cause ignition problems. A proper installation is where a tech checks the gas pressure, temp rise, safeties etc. Most of the time that is not done. We had brand new Smartvalve gas valves out of the box overfirng at 4"WC and burned out a lot of new furnaces so anything is possible. Now getting older HWell valves that the regulators are failing. The orifice in the pilot burner may be plugging and distorting the flame. May need a new pilot burner as they can warp. Will wait and see if cleaning the burners helped.

I get all my gas valves: 1) OEM from Reznor/Lennox or whoever mostly for liability reasons and compatibility issues. 2) Cross referenced by my favorite wholesaler who I trust.
There are 3 types of valves; quick open, step open, slow open and you cannot just interchange part numbers. The reason it lights better when warm I suspect is the heat exchanger has expanded and the burners move or something else happens. All that backfiring is very dangerous and HARD on the heat exchanger and it is 2x the size you really need for your shop. If it has not been burning cleanly OR overfired/oversized you may have a partially plugged heat exchanger/cracked heat exchanger/damaged internal baffles etc which can affect the draft etc. Not much more I can help you with without actually seeing it for myself.
